Academic Standing Policy

Once a year, the Graduate Studies Coordinator reviews the academic standing of all graduate students.

Academic standing requirements for graduate students in the Department of English are more stringent than University requirements. Graduate students who fail to maintain acceptable academic standing are at risk of academic probation and/or dismissal.

For students in coursework, the Department's minimum requirements for acceptable academic standing are as follows:

  • M.A. or M.F.A. students on appointment: minimum 3.25 GPA
  • M.A. or M.F.A. students not on appointment: minimum 3.00 GPA
  • Ph.D. students on appointment: minimum 3.50 GPA
  • Ph.D. students not on appointment: minimum 3.25 GPA

In the case of Ph.D. students who are no longer in coursework, the Graduate Coordinator solicits an annual academic standing recommendation from the student's advisor.

The University academic standing policy for graduate students is part of the graduate catalog.
